Software Engineer Intern

Meta builds technologies that help people connect, find communities, and grow businesses. They are moving beyond 2D screens toward immersive experiences like augmented and virtual reality.
Backend
Software Engineering Intern
In-Person
5,000+ Employees
AI · AR/VR · Enterprise SaaS

Description For Software Engineer Intern

Meta is seeking Software Engineer Interns to join their engineering team. As a Software Engineer at Meta, you'll drive the development of systems behind Meta's products, create web applications that reach billions of people, build high volume servers, and be part of a team working to help people connect globally. The internship has a minimum twelve-week duration.

Responsibilities include:

  • Develop and push production-ready code
  • Complete assigned tasks efficiently
  • Identify problem statements and outline optimal solutions
  • Communicate effectively across multiple stakeholders

Qualifications:

  • Currently enrolled in a full-time, degree-seeking program (Bachelor's or Master's in Computer Science or related field)
  • Experience coding in an industry-standard language (e.g., Java, Python, C++, Objective-C, JavaScript)
  • Must obtain work authorization in the country of employment

Preferred Qualifications:

  • Demonstrated software engineering experience from previous internships, work experience, coding competitions, or publications
  • Intent to return to degree program after internship completion

Meta offers a fast-paced development cycle, allowing interns to make an immediate impact. The company is committed to equal employment opportunity and provides reasonable accommodations for candidates with disabilities or special needs.

Last updated 2 months ago

Responsibilities For Software Engineer Intern

  • Develop and push production-ready code by quickly ramping on assigned codebase, product area, and/or system
  • Complete assigned tasks efficiently with few iterations
  • Identify problem statements, outline optimal solutions, account for tradeoffs and edge cases
  • Communicate effectively across multiple stakeholders

Requirements For Software Engineer Intern

Java
Python
JavaScript
  • Currently enrolled in a full-time, degree-seeking program (Bachelor's or Master's in Computer Science or related field)
  • Experience coding in an industry-standard language (e.g., Java, Python, C++, Objective-C, JavaScript)
  • Must obtain work authorization in country of employment

Benefits For Software Engineer Intern

  • Equal Employment Opportunity
  • Accommodations for candidates with disabilities or special needs

Interested in this job?

Jobs Related To Meta Software Engineer Intern

Internship, Fullstack Software Engineer, Maps & Self-Driving Navigation (Summer 2025)

Summer 2025 internship opportunity at Tesla working on Maps & Self-Driving Navigation, developing full-stack features for Autopilot and in-car navigation systems.

Internship, Fullstack Engineer, Build Infrastructure (Summer 2025)

Summer 2025 Fullstack Engineering Internship at Tesla, focusing on build infrastructure and developer tools, offering hands-on experience with distributed systems and cloud computing.

Internship, Product Engineer, Applications Engineering (Summer 2025)

Summer 2025 Product Engineering internship at Tesla, focusing on applications engineering and product management.

Internship, Industrial Engineer, Manufacturing (Summer 2025)

Summer 2025 Industrial Engineering internship at Tesla, focusing on manufacturing optimization and process improvement in automotive production.

Internship, Analysis Engineer, Vehicle & Powertrain Engineering (Summer 2025)

Summer 2025 internship opportunity at Tesla for Analysis Engineers, focusing on vehicle and powertrain engineering using CAE simulation tools.